My Approach

I am convinced that successful osteopathic treatment involves more than simply addressing individual symptoms. That is why I take a whole-person approach, with a particular interest in the interaction between the musculoskeletal system, the nervous system, digestion, and lifestyle factors.

At the core of my work is the question of why symptoms have developed and which factors may be contributing to their persistence. Based on this understanding, I work together with my patients to create an individualized treatment plan tailored to their specific needs.

My main areas of focus are migraines and headaches, irritable bowel syndrome (IBS), and musculoskeletal disorders.

I hold a Bachelor of Science in Osteopathy and am a licensed naturopathic practitioner (Heilpraktiker). My goal is not only to provide high-quality treatment, but also to help you gain a better understanding of your health and empower you to actively support your well-being in the long term.
